Vince McMahon as a heavy non-wrestling presence on television in early 2022 was hard to justify. Vince McMahon working matches in-ring at WrestleMania? Certainly not. Coming out to address the fans or make matches was one thing, but getting in there on the biggest weekender of the year was another.

Yikes.

McMahon worked Pat McAfee in a thrown-together match during 'Mania 38's second night. McAfee had already beaten Austin Theory, which was enough of a sideshow for the event, but then the loudmouth announcer goaded Vince into an impromptu bout too. Fans popped at first, then the bell rang.

Nobody was expecting Bryan Danielson or AJ Styles out there, but McMahon couldn't even be a decent version of himself. Putting this on the lineup at WrestleMania, unadvertised add-on or not, was a ridiculous decision from someone who was pathetically out of touch.
